1. "Supernatural": If you enjoyed the supernatural elements and eerie settings of a show like "Supernatural," you might also like "Grimm." This series follows a homicide detective who discovers that he is a Grimm, a hunter tasked with keeping the balance between humanity and mythological creatures. 2. "Riverdale": For fans of the dark and mysterious tone of "Riverdale," "Bates Motel" could be a great pick. This prequel to Alfred Hitchcock's "Psycho" explores the complex relationship between a young Norman Bates and his overbearing mother as they run a motel in a small town. 3. "The Flash": Viewers who are drawn to the superhero action of "The Flash" might enjoy "Arrow." This series follows billionaire playboy Oliver Queen as he returns home after being stranded on a deserted island and becomes a vigilante archer fighting crime in Star City. 4. "Once Upon a Time": If you loved the fairytale elements and intertwining storylines of "Once Upon a Time," you might like "Grimm." This show follows a Portland homicide detective who discovers he is a Grimm, a guardian charged with keeping the balance between humanity and mythological creatures. 5. "The 100": Fans of the post-apocalyptic setting and survival themes in "The 100" may find "The Walking Dead" intriguing. This series follows a group of survivors navigating a world overrun by zombies where the real threat may come from other living humans.
